Overall, it is a really good open source library management software. BiblioteQ is another free open source ebook manager software for Windows. The main purpose of this software is to catalog books , journals , magazine , games , etc.

It can be used by different organizations including libraries , schools , and churches. In it, you also get support for PostgreSQL and SQLite connections in order to retrieve information about ebooks, journals, magazines, etc.

In order to manage ebooks, it provides various features like Search to search any ebook by its Book title, book ID and book category , Add Item to add new books along with all their information like author name, book ID, publisher, etc.

The good thing about this freeware is that it can also fetch book covers , cover arts, etc. It comes with a simple and straightforward interface, so you will easily be able to manage a large collection of ebooks with it.

Apart from managing and storing books information in this software, you can also export all the saved ebooks collection information as a CSV file. This is another nice open source ebook manager in this list.

Pros E-book converter: With Calibre you can take an e-book in one file format and convert it to another that is supported by your e-book reading device and, if you're not happy with the result, you can tweak the conversion settings and even manually edit the book's contents and formatting.

Cons Crowded interface: There is a lot going on when you start using the app; just on the main screen there are three search fields and 15 buttons, many of which come with drop-down menus. Multi-Language Capabilities If you want to write a story partially or wholly in a language other than English, double-check that the eBook creator you choose supports it.

The best software makes it easy to choose your language or switch between languages without disrupting your workflow or inadvertently creating weird characters, typos and unexpected formatting issues. Cloud vs. Does it save it to its server via the cloud, or do you download the software onto your computer? To use cloud software, you need a solid internet connection, so it is a good option if you plan to write at home or a cafe.

On the other hand, if you write during your commute on the train, it may be better to find a program you can download. There are pros and cons to both, so consider your situation before making a decision.
